Neil Evans' Tips For Goulburn (Thursday)

By Neil Evans

Track likely Soft 5 and rail out 6m:

Race 1 MAIDEN PLATE (1300m):

We open with the maidens on a track that will continue to firm with sunshine finally replacing earlier rain. Keen on home track filly 11. Dolce Bella 24 days since running home okay on debut here when hard in the market. Wasn't easy to make up ground that day, and with that experience jumping from a softer draw and carrying 1kg less, she can break through.

Dangers: You couldn't miss the first up closing run of 5. Raider Eightyeight at Canberra a fortnight ago, and naturally a bit more ground suits. Another one trained on the track, 12. Stormy Witness returns off a 10-week freshen up and quiet trial; while at bigger odds 1. Great Week and 9. My Little Viking both add value to trifectas and first fours.

How to play it: Dolce Bella to win
Odds and Evens: Odds

Race 2 CLASS 1 & MAIDEN PLATE (2140m):

Well out in distance we go, and after three runs back, this looks at the mercy of well bred metro four-year-old 1. I Am The Empire by prize UK staying sire Camelot. Has been in the money all three runs this time, twice in much deeper provincial company, and looks well treated carrying half kilo less than he did in a BM 64 at Newcastle.

Dangers: Big watch at the value around four-year-old 5. Poker Dice who looms as the quinella runner fifth-up from a good trailing gate. Worked home okay last time in a race with more depth, and in-form Sydney apprentice takes over in the saddle. Include in wider exotics, 2. Inti deep into his prep; and 7. Bonus Tempus who will enjoy the significant step up in distance.

How to play it: Quinella: 1 and 5
Odds and Evens: Odds

Race 3 CLASS 1 HCP (1200m):

Metro-based filly 5. The Seven Seas is the clear one to beat here after the scratching of the hot favourite. Tracked the speed and went home strong to win with something in hand-up first-up, and headed for deeper races than this.

Dangers: Improving three-year-old 3. Russian Assassin can peak third-up; 4. Bully For You improves after disappointing second-up when easy in betting; and 7. Discreet Miss comes back in class fourth-up.

How to play it: The Seven Seas to win
Odds and Evens: Odds

Race 4 MAIDEN HCP (1000m):

The five furlong dash is right up the alley of Randwick three-year-old 2. Troika second-up. Settled well back from a wide gate and finished only fairly on a wet Beaumont track when resuming, but firmer ground and bigger track are significant plusses here.

Dangers: Got enough time for honest filly 5. Rebel Love who has been fair in slightly deeper company three runs this prep, and gets blinkers added. Keep safe 8. Graceful Force third-up for a leading city stable, with blinkers also going on; while 7. Just Wai is down in class third-up.

How to play it: Troika to win
Odds and Evens: Split

Race 5 BENCHMARK 58 HCP (1000m):

Staying at the short course for a Heat of the Rising Star, and there's good depth here. Like four-year-old metro mare 2. Squiggles resuming off an 18 week break behind two quiet trials. Was around the money in deeper company last prep, and is already a fresh winner for a stable that likes to get them ready. By Shalaa so any cut out of the ground is a bonus.

Dangers: Promising home track filly 8. Namid reloads after missing a run a couple of weeks back. Launched her career with a comfortable all-the-way win in a weak country maiden, and looks fairly treated at the weights after the claim. Respect for 4. Evanora suited over the short trip, and the more it dries out the better she's served. Include local mare 1. London Gal fifth-up; and 7. Tablet second-up; in trifectas and first fours.

How to play it: Squiggles to win
Odds and Evens: Evens

Race 6 MAIDEN HCP (1500m):

Open race with plenty of chances, but leaning heavily to metro three-year-old 3. Passionate Rebel who is ready to win at his third start. Was well backed when finishing okay on debut in the country before failing to finish off in better provincial company. Less depth here, and wants a surface with some give in it.

Dangers: Keep very safe 2. Fierce Legend second-up after leading for a long way in a handy Canberra maiden. Deep into his prep, and with an edge in race fitness, 1. Sizzler goes up a hefty 5kg in weight, but finds a thinner race after holding his own against city opposition; while stablemates 5. Domingo with blinkers coming off; and 8. Aunt Roberta who drew the fence; are both market watches resuming behind two quiet trials.

How to play it: Passionate Rebel to win
Odds And Evens: Split

Race 7 BENCHMARK 66 HCP (1300m):

Nearly always a stack of chances at this level, and this one is no different. After one fair closing run back in tougher metro grade, seven-year-old 4. Reoffender looms as the one to beat. Can settle back around midfield from a wider draw, and saves his best form for rain-affected ground.

Dangers: Big watch on 6. Reggie's Folly peaking fourth-up from a softer draw. Similarly, local mare 7. Our Baez looks well placed on the speed map fourth-up and coming through some very handy formlines. Keep safe tough-as-teak 9. My Girona sneaking down in the weights third-up; while both 5. Eberlee second-upin suitable ground; and home tracker 11. Ribeauville resuming off a quiet trial; are also in the each way mix.

How to play it: Reoffender to win
Odds and Evens: Split

Race 8 BENCHMARK 58 HCP (1600m):

We finish over the mile, and it shapes nicely for underrated South Coast five-year-old 2. Lights On The Hill fourth-up. Liked how he hit the line late from well back in a handy CL2 19 days ago when stepping up to this distance, and right at his peak now.

Dangers: Emerging local filly 8. Arts Object surged home from just off the speed to claim a similar graded race for the girls here 11 days ago, and carries the same weight. Must include progressive and lightly raced 4. Zabellsareringing who finished hard in a CL1 three weeks after sweeping home from well back for an impressive maiden win. Watch the betting on ex-Qld mare 1. Evita La Vie resuming for her first start in the new country NSW stable, with blinkers back on. Included in exotics home tracker 7. Neidr Dawn with blinkers replacing winkers deep into the prep.

How to play it: Lights On The Hill each way
Odds and Evens: Evens

BEST BETS:
R1 11. DOLCE BELLA
R4 2. TROIKA

BEST VALUE:
R5 2. SQUIGGLES
